#af109c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#af109c is composed of 68.6% red, 6.3%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.9% magenta, 10.9%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 307.2 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 37.5%. #af109c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#5f0039.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

● #af109c color description : Dark magenta.
The hexadecimal color #af109c has RGB values of R:175, G:16,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.11,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11473052.
